Runbook: DB pool exhaustion on Cobblewire

Symptoms: timeouts, queued queries, rising 503s. First check active connections against the pool cap. Do not raise the cap without approval — the database node in the Renlow rack saturates above 400 connections total. Recycle idle connections, then restart the API workers one at a time. The pooler currently runs with these settings.

settings of fajop-fahap:
[holeth]
port = 9300
team = juleth
host = holeth.tolvaqsoft.example
region = south-4
access_code = ac_4bcdf6
timeout_ms = 500

## Replica Lag Alarm (Quornix Reads)

If the lag alarm on the Quornix read replica fires, don't panic — it's usually a long-running analytics query hogging the apply thread. Check pg_stat_replication, kill anything from the reporting user older than ten minutes, and watch lag drop. If it doesn't recover in fifteen minutes, page the data team. To inspect the replica directly, connect using the string below.

replica DSN, yahog-kawig: redis://istox_svc:um@db-8a67.halixforge.test:5432/frawyn

// Config hot-reloading for the Brindlemere client.
// The watcher polls /etc/brindlemere/client.toml every 15s and applies
// changes without a restart. Connection pool size, retry budgets, and
// timeout values are all reloadable; endpoint URLs are not, by design,
// since swapping hosts mid-flight corrupted the session cache in the
// 3.2 release. Reload events are logged at INFO so the release manager
// can confirm rollout without shelling in. The client authenticates to
// the internal Fennic registry with the key that follows.

app token of tageg-kadug = vxb2-26

Subject: Handover — Laneguard circuit breaker

Hi Maret,

Handing over the circuit breaker we added in front of the Pellway upstream API. It trips after five consecutive 5xx responses within thirty seconds, holds open for two minutes, then half-opens with a single probe. Trip events and state transitions are written to the audit table, so the security review can verify nothing is silently swallowed. To inspect the breaker state history, connect to the audit database using the string below.

— Dovan

replica DSN, kajep-yahag: mssql://praok_svc:iF@db-8d68.plorvaio.local:5432/eliion